Club Delphi  
    FTP   CCD     Buscar   Trucos   Trabajo   Foros

Retroceder   Foros Club Delphi > Principal > Varios
Registrarse FAQ Miembros Calendario Guía de estilo Temas de Hoy

Grupo de Teaming del ClubDelphi

Respuesta
 
Herramientas Buscar en Tema Desplegado
  #1  
Antiguo 09-11-2003
Avatar de DarkByte
DarkByte DarkByte is offline
Miembro
 
Registrado: sep 2003
Ubicación: Desconocido
Posts: 1.322
Poder: 22
DarkByte Va por buen camino
Capturar una instantánea en un TImage

Hola de nuevo. ¿Cómo puedo hacer que mi aplicación capture la imagen de la pantalla y la meta en un TImage?

Es algo al estilo del truco 185 de trucomanía, pero a pantalla completa, y sin saber la resolución de la pantalla.


¡¡¡Necesito ayuda en un hilo!!!, es urgente!!
__________________
:)
Responder Con Cita
  #2  
Antiguo 10-11-2003
Avatar de madman
madman madman is offline
Miembro
 
Registrado: may 2003
Ubicación: Nayarit, México
Posts: 242
Poder: 22
madman Va por buen camino
http://www.clubdelphi.com/foros/show...=&threadid=794
__________________
Guía de Estilo.
Responder Con Cita
  #3  
Antiguo 22-11-2003
Avatar de DarkByte
DarkByte DarkByte is offline
Miembro
 
Registrado: sep 2003
Ubicación: Desconocido
Posts: 1.322
Poder: 22
DarkByte Va por buen camino
Lo siento, confundo el código que es para enviar la imagen y para capturar la imagen, ¿alguien me lo aclara?
__________________
:)
Responder Con Cita
  #4  
Antiguo 24-11-2003
Avatar de madman
madman madman is offline
Miembro
 
Registrado: may 2003
Ubicación: Nayarit, México
Posts: 242
Poder: 22
madman Va por buen camino
Mas facil no puede estar...

Código:
{Crea una imagen, capturando lo que existe en la pantalla actual} 

procedure TForm1.CrearImg(_path: string; _file:string);
En:
Código:
procedure TForm1.TimerSendImgTimer(Sender: TObject);
var
...
...
begin
   strPath:=ExtractFileDir(Application.ExeName)+'';
   CrearImg(strPath,'imgtmp.jpg'); //Creamos la imagen 
   mi_jpeg:=TJPEGImage.Create;
   mi_jpeg.LoadFromFile(strPath+'imgtmp.jpg'); //cargamos la imagen
...
...
Este procedimiento es para estar tomando imagenes cada 5 segundos.

Para crear solo una imagen, solo manda llamar a CrearImg(Directorio, NombreFile); Directorio=Donde quieres que se guarde. NombreFile=Con ke nombre kieres ke se guarde el archivo .JPG.

No creo que este tan dificil de comprender el codigo, esta comentado y explico tantillo sobre el.

Bueno en fin, espero que esten aclaradas tus dudas (al menos para este hilo).

Salu2!
__________________
Guía de Estilo.

Última edición por madman fecha: 24-11-2003 a las 04:48:56.
Responder Con Cita
Respuesta



Normas de Publicación
no Puedes crear nuevos temas
no Puedes responder a temas
no Puedes adjuntar archivos
no Puedes editar tus mensajes

El código vB está habilitado
Las caritas están habilitado
Código [IMG] está habilitado
Código HTML está deshabilitado
Saltar a Foro


La franja horaria es GMT +2. Ahora son las 15:14:03.


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i
Copyright 1996-2007 Club Delphi